It is possible really for an earthquake to happen anywhere. Or at least really anywhere can feel the effects of one. Earthquakes are caused by shifts in the earth's crust, so if you live on or near a fault line, or the line where two of earth's tectonic plates meet, then erthquakes are likely as those plates shift and collide.
